The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E has an overall score of 61.7, which is slightly better than Alcatel PLUS 12's 58.9 overall score.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E counts with Android 4.1 operating system, while Alcatel PLUS 12 comes with Windows 10 operating system. The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E is an a lot older and thicker tablet than the Alcatel PLUS 12, but Samsung managed to make it incredibly lighter anyway.
The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E has a bit more vivid screen than Alcatel PLUS 12, although it has a bit lower display density, a much smaller screen and a lot lower resolution of 600 x 1024. Alcatel PLUS 12 counts with a very superior memory for apps and games than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E, because it has more internal storage capacity and a SD memory card expansion slot that supports up to 128 GB.
The Alcatel PLUS 12 features a bit better processor than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E, because although it has doesn't have an extra graphics co-processor, and they both have a Dual-Core CPU, the Alcatel PLUS 12 also counts with a higher amount of RAM memory.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E has a much better camera than Alcatel PLUS 12.
Alcatel PLUS 12 counts with a very superior battery performance than Samsung Galaxy Tab 2 (7.0) LTE, because it has a 6900mAh battery capacity against 4000mAh.
